Propulsion

Propulsion technology influences spacecraft lifetime, station keeping, payload flexibility, and total mission economics. Propulsion represents a critical technology layer as operators seek longer operational periods and efficient orbital control. Chemical propulsion remains established, while electric propulsion gains adoption through efficiency advantages. The segment holds a 100%–100% structural share and a 8.21% CAGR as propulsion requirements remain integral to every spacecraft configuration.

  • Chemical: Chemical propulsion provides high thrust for launch-phase maneuvers, orbit raising, and rapid attitude corrections, supporting established spacecraft architectures requiring immediate maneuvering capability.
  • Electric: Electric propulsion offers high specific impulse and reduced propellant consumption, improving spacecraft mass efficiency and supporting longer operational lifetimes and flexible orbital management.
  • Hybrid: Hybrid propulsion combines high-thrust chemical systems with efficient electric propulsion, balancing maneuverability and fuel economy for missions requiring diverse orbital operations.

Type

Spacecraft size influences payload capacity, launch economics, power availability, and mission complexity. Small GEO platforms are gaining attention for distributed architectures, while medium and large spacecraft remain important for high-capacity missions. The Type segment maintains a 100%–100% structural share and follows an 8.21% CAGR, reflecting continued diversification in spacecraft design and mission requirements across commercial and institutional customers.

  • Small GEO (<2000 kg): Small GEO satellites enable lower-cost deployment, faster production cycles, and distributed capacity, making them increasingly relevant for defense, regional communications, and flexible constellation strategies.
  • Medium GEO (2000-4000 kg): Medium GEO platforms balance payload capacity and launch economics, supporting broadband, broadcasting, enterprise connectivity, and government missions requiring substantial regional coverage.
  • Large GEO (>4000 kg): Large GEO satellites provide high power, extensive payload capacity, and broad coverage, supporting high-throughput communications and complex missions requiring substantial onboard resources.

Market Restraints and Challenges

Complex Launch Requirements

Factor: Launching GEO spacecraft requires sophisticated launch vehicles, orbital insertion procedures, regulatory coordination, insurance coverage, and precise spacecraft commissioning. Impact: Failure or delayed launches will postpone earning revenues, raise costs, affect planning, and even delay replacement cycles due to aging satellites. Even though the cost-effectiveness of reusable space launches is improving through advances in technology, missions to geosynchronous orbits still need unique techniques for transferring into those orbits and extensive tests post-launch. Electric propulsion can reduce propellant requirements but generally increases the time required for final orbit raising.

Orbital Congestion Concerns

Factor: Increasing spacecraft populations and debris accumulation are raising the operational complexity of satellite missions and increasing the importance of collision avoidance, tracking, and end-of-life disposal. Impact: Higher monitoring standards, more maneuver coordination, and potential increases in regulatory costs and insurance are all challenges faced by operators. This makes it even more essential to have responsible space management and space traffic services. The Geo Satellite Market analysis has to take into account orbital sustainability when fleet planning, spacecraft design, disposal procedures, and long-term asset management.
